I play on Server 3 and Server 6. A lot of the buggy and laggy issues have been addressed. I think the game is pretty addictive actually. Depends a lot on your play style. I would say that is a bit hard for a casual gamer to get into that much. It actually needs a good bit of your time to play well.
It borrows a lot of the city building style from Civ games and/or early WarCraft, not WoW, just plain WarCraft. But it also throws you in there with lots of other people trying to fight, build, and survive.
I'd recommend it to anyone looking to try out a free browser based game.
You do not really understand something unless you can explain it to your grandmother.
- Albert Einstein